def _unellipsize_tab_labels(root: Gtk.Widget) -> None:
"""Walk every Gtk.Label under `root` (INCLUDING internal-template
children) and turn off ellipsize + width-cap.
Why this is needed in three layers of confusion:
1. HdyPreferencesWindow puts its tab strip inside an internal HdyHeaderBar
that get_children() doesn't expose -- you have to use forall() to
reach the titlebar's descendants.
2. Each HdyViewSwitcherButton wraps an internal Stack that holds *two*
GtkLabel instances per tab (one for the wide layout, one for
narrow). Both have ellipsize=PANGO_ELLIPSIZE_END set in C and
allocations like 36 px, so they crop to 'Availat' / 'Installe'.
3. CSS cannot reach the ellipsize attribute -- it's a widget property,
not a CSS one.
So: forall-walk the realised tree, find every label, force
ellipsize=NONE on it. With ellipsize off, the label demands its
natural width and the parent reallocates accordingly.
"""
tab_names = {"Available", "Installed", "Custom", "Order"}
def visit(widget: Gtk.Widget) -> None:
if isinstance(widget, Gtk.Label):
try:
widget.set_ellipsize(Pango.EllipsizeMode.NONE)
widget.set_max_width_chars(-1)
text = widget.get_text() or ""
if text in tab_names:
# width_chars alone wasn't enough: HdyViewSwitcher's
# internal Gtk.Stack allocates each tab a fixed slot
# that still clipped the last character. Force a
# generous pixel-based minimum and let the parent
# widen instead of cropping us. ~14 px per character
# is roomy for the system font.
widget.set_width_chars(len(text) + 2)
widget.set_size_request(len(text) * 14, -1)
widget.set_hexpand(True)
else:
widget.set_width_chars(-1)
except Exception:
pass
if isinstance(widget, Gtk.Container):
children = []
try:
# forall() exposes internal-template children that the
# public get_children() hides - that's where the tab
# labels live.
widget.forall(lambda c, _: children.append(c), None)
except Exception:
children = widget.get_children()
for child in children:
visit(child)
visit(root)
# Also queue a re-run on the next idle cycle. HdyViewSwitcherTitle
# has an internal GtkStack that swaps between wide and narrow layouts
# based on allocated width, and the swap may happen AFTER the first
# show_all -- which would replace the labels we just patched. Re-
# patching from idle catches the post-swap labels too.
def _again():
visit(root)
return False
GLib.idle_add(_again)
GLib.timeout_add(150, _again)
